Crafted for the Asian Silhouette

“At Wunn Bridal, our primary focus is to curate a collection that truly complements the Asian silhouette and caters to the preferences of our local brides,” says Rachel, co-founder of Wunn Bridal. Their design curation starts with a thoughtful understanding of form. Wunn collaborates predominantly with Asian designers who possess a nuanced grasp of the proportions and body ratios typical among Asian women. This intentional collaboration results in a showcase of gown designs with waistlines, gown lengths, and fits that are naturally more flattering and size-friendly for their clientele.

Peeking into the future of bridal fashion, Rachel shares that Asian bridal designers are leaning into a refined elegance that’s gaining traction among their brides. “One key trend is the growing preference for understated luxury—brides are moving towards gowns that are refined and elegant, with high-quality fabrics and thoughtful detailing, rather than overly embellished pieces.” Fabrics like mikado silk, satin organza, and lightweight tulle are leading the way, chosen for their structural beauty and comfort in tropical climates.

As for silhouettes, the atelier accent dresses with clean lines, architectural draping, and asymmetrical necklines, often accented by traditional motifs—phoenixes, cranes, florals—subtly woven into the design. “It’s a beautiful evolution,” Rachel notes. “Asian bridal designers are blending cultural artistry with global sophistication, creating gowns that feel both meaningful and fashion-forward.”

How Wunn Chooses Gowns That Speak to Asian Brides

Curation at Wunn Bridal is as intimate as it is intentional. Rachel and her team don’t simply rely on catalogs or collections—they meet personally with designers and test each gown for fit, feel and visual impact.

Each gown is hand-selected and tried on personally by the team—a rare and meticulous approach that ensures every piece in their collection meets both aesthetic and functional expectations. “We believe the right gown cutting plays a crucial role in enhancing a bride’s overall appearance,” Rachel adds. “A well-fitted gown can dramatically elevate her confidence and presence on her big day.” It’s this rigorous, empathetic approach that allows Wunn to present a collection that truly resonates with today’s Asian bride.
